数据库运维的选购是一个复杂的过程,涉及多个方面的考量。以下是一些关键步骤和考虑因素:
数据库运维基础概念
数据库运维是指对数据库系统进行管理、监控和维护的工作,包括数据库的安装、配置、备份、恢复、性能优化、故障排除等方面的工作。其目标是确保数据库系统的稳定性、可靠性和高效性。
数据库运维的优势
- 数据安全性高:通过实施数据备份、恢复、加密等措施,确保数据的安全性。
- 性能优化:通过对数据库的监控和调优,提升数据库的性能。
- 故障处理能力强:具备丰富的故障处理经验和技能,能够快速诊断和解决数据库故障。
- 备份和恢复能力强:能够制定完善的备份策略,定期对数据库进行备份,并能够快速恢复数据。
- 系统监控和维护能力强:通过实时监控数据库的运行状态,及时发现并解决潜在的问题。
数据库运维类型
- 数据库监控:提供实时监控数据库的运行状态和性能指标。
- 数据库性能优化:通过优化数据库配置、查询语句和索引等方式,提高数据库的性能和响应速度。
- 数据库备份和恢复:定期对数据库进行备份,并能在发生故障或数据丢失时快速恢复数据库。
- 数据库安全管理:设置权限和访问控制,保护数据库的机密性和完整性,预防数据泄露和非法访问。
数据库运维应用场景
- 企业管理:管理大量的数据,包括员工信息、客户信息、销售数据、财务数据等。
- 电子商务:存储大量的商品信息、订单信息、用户信息等数据。
- 社交网络:存储大量的用户信息、好友关系、动态信息等数据。
- 物联网:存储大量的传感器数据、设备信息等数据。
- 游戏开发:存储大量的游戏数据、用户信息等数据。
在选择数据库运维解决方案时,企业应根据自身的业务需求、技术实力和运维能力进行综合考虑,选择最适合自己的方案。